**Cancer Research UK is the world's largest charity dedicated to beating all types of cancer. We now have an opportunity for you to join us as a Graphic Design Intern.

_What will I be doing? _

With fresh ideas, enthusiasm and a passion for design, you'll join Cancer Research UK's fast-pace and lively design studio to help deliver effective and engaging design solutions.

Role and Purpose
**Design in Cancer Research UK's creative team, The Studio, includes Graphic, Motion, Information and Product Design teams. As part of a large multidisciplinary team, you'll collaborate daily and work side-by-side with other design specialists to come up with ideas, support team projects and deliver design solutions. This is a hands-on position - you'll use your design expertise to deliver high-quality and impactful communications for Cancer Research UK and partner brands across all marketing and communication channels.

Together we work to support Cancer Research UK's vision for a future where everyone lives longer, better lives, free from the fear of cancer.

_What will I gain? _
**This role will add real value to Cancer Research UK so we want to ensure you're getting a lot out of it too. As an intern you'll go through a structured development programme with skills training in project management, CV writing and interview skills and you'll have a buddy to help you settle in. You'll be eligible for many of our benefits, including paid holiday, and you'll gain key experience to help you launch your career.
